Highland Golf Course201 Von Elm Ln Pocatello, ID 83201 Phone: (208)237-9922
The terrain on this course is hilly and rolling. The only water hazard is a pond just off the tee box on hole #16, a 160-yard, par 3. The fairways are fairly wide open and lined with some pines and Russian Olive trees. The greens have several subtle breaks which make them difficult to putt.

| When we were in our late teens and 20's and refining our golf skills, we would play this course to test our nerves and agility. It was long, dusty, long (emphasis on long), and unforgiving. And did I say long? (especially when the famous Idaho wind blew). Now, the trees are huge, the fairways are fabulous, and the greens are as nasty as ever. Many of my friends simply cannot pass through Pocatello anymore without still stopping to play this course. Play both this course and Riverside, and you'll get a taste of the best golf in southern Idaho. |
